Oracle Training Oracle Support Development Oracle Apps

 
 Home
 E-mail Us
 Oracle Articles
New Oracle Articles


 Oracle Training
 Oracle Tips

 Oracle Forum
 Class Catalog


 Remote DBA
 Oracle Tuning
 Emergency 911
 RAC Support
 Apps Support
 Analysis
 Design
 Implementation
 Oracle Support


 SQL Tuning
 Security

 Oracle UNIX
 Oracle Linux
 Monitoring
 Remote s
upport
 Remote plans
 Remote
services
 Application Server

 Applications
 Oracle Forms
 Oracle Portal
 App Upgrades
 SQL Server
 Oracle Concepts
 Software Support

 Remote S
upport  
 Development  

 Implementation


 Consulting Staff
 Consulting Prices
 Help Wanted!

 


 Oracle Posters
 Oracle Books

 Oracle Scripts
 Ion
 Excel-DB  

Don Burleson Blog 


 

 

 


 

 

 

Oracle Snapshot Replication & Streams Training Class

2007-2016 by Burleson Corporation

 

 

This course is taught at your Company site with up to 20 students. 

Click here for on-site course prices

Optional supplemental mentoring

 

   
Key Features

* Learn the internal mechanisms of Oracle snapshot refreshing.

* Understand how to leverage Oracle multimaster replication.

* See the underlying Oracle views for monitoring replication and streams.

* Learn the architecture of Oracle multimaster replication and Oracle Streams in simple terms with illustrative examples.

* Create working examples of snapshot creation, refresh, and error detection scripts.

* Understand details real-world techniques for implement conflict resolution in multi-master replication.

* Understand the successful installation and configuration techniques, reliable failover database, and subscribed destinations.
 

  

Course Description

Unlike some mediocre Oracle replication training, this course examines all Oracle distributed database and replication features with an eye on those features that are the most important to you.

This Oracle replication training is special because this course is taught by a veteran Oracle Certified DBA with more than 20 years of full-time experience.  This Oracle replication class can also be customized according to your specific needs.
 

Book Required

Audience

This course is designed for practicing Oracle professionals who have basic experience with Oracle. Prior experience with Oracle is not required, but experience using Oracle database is highly desirable.
 

 

Curriculum Design

This course was designed by Donald K. Burleson, an acknowledged leader in Oracle database administration.  Author of more than 30 database books, Burleson was chosen by Oracle Press to write five authorized editions, including Oracle High-Performance SQL tuning.  Burleson Corporation instructors offer decades of real world DBA experience in Oracle features, and they will share their secrets in this intense Oracle training.  Burleson also served as the Editor for the premier book Oracle10g New Features for the DBA by Rampant TechPress.



Oracle Snapshot Replication & Streams Training
3-Day Syllabus

Copyright 2007-2016 by Donald K. Burleson

 

DAY 1
 
Introduction to the Oracle Replication Architecture   
The Oracle Replication Architecture  
Database links
Basics of distributed updates
Inside the two-phase commit
Basics of Snapshot and Multi-master Replication  
Manual Replication techniques  
 
Installing Oracle Advanced Replication  

Overview of the replication packages
Checklist for installing advanced replication
  •    Creating the users
  •    Setting Oracle parameters
  •    Creating database links
  •    Managing replication security
  •    Testing replication
Basic read-only Replication with snapshots  

Read-Only Snapshot architecture
Restrictions of read-only snapshots  
Snapshot Creation Basics  
Setting the refresh interval
Complex Snapshot creation  
Creating and managing snapshot logs  
Subquery Sub-setting in snapshots  
Refresh Groups for snapshots
 
Using Oracle Updateable Snapshots  

Background in updateable snapshots  
Defining Updateable Snapshots  
Defining refresh intervals  

 

DAY 2
 

Using Updateable Materialized Views
 
Defining updatable materialized views
 
Monitoring Oracle Replication with Scripts

Goals of monitoring replication
Scripts to measure pending updates
Auto-correct script for broken snapshots

Using Oracle Procedural Replication  


Introduction to procedural replication
Installing the replication packages  
Restrictions on Procedural Replication  
 
Oracle Multi-Master Replication  

Background on multi-master replication
Restriction & limitations of multi-master replication
Using the Oracle-supplied packages
Defining Replication Groups  
Defining the master site
Defining propagation rules  
Using  the dbms_repcat package
Replication of data definitions (DDL)  
 
Conflict Avoidance in multi-master replication  

The causes of data conflicts
The options for conflict resolution
Using Referential Integrity with multi-master replication
Techniques to avoid data conflicts
Implementing an automated conflict avoidance mechanism
Manual intervention and conflict detection

 

 

 
DAY 3
 
Introduction to Oracle Streams

Data Sharing

• Growing Need
• Global Operations
• Heterogeneous Systems

Data Synchronization

• Data Movement
• Data Transformation
• Data Migration
• Data Replication

What is Oracle Streams?

Why Oracle Streams?

Where to use Streams Mechanism
• Replication
• AQ – Advanced Queuing
• Event Management
• Data Loading
• Summarization of Data
• High Availability and Disaster Recovery

Streams Historical Growth
• Advanced Replication
• Advanced Queuing

Related Oracle Technologies
• Log Miner
• Standby – Data Guard

Peer Products
• Sybase Replication
• Quest Shareplex
• GoldenGate
• Data Mirror



Streams Components and Processes

Producer and Consumer
LCR Object

• Row LCR
• DDL LCR
• Additional Attributes

Hot Mining and Cold Mining
Log based Changes
Capture Process
Propagation of Changes
Apply Process
Queuing and Dequeuing

Rules and Rules Engine
• Application of Rules
• Transformation
• Contexts

Streams Tags

Directed Network
DownStreams Capture
Change Data Capture
LogMiner
Supplemental Logging
Sys.Anydata Object
DML Handlers


Streams Replication

• Database Changes
• User Application Message

Destination Database
Data Types for Replication
Rules

• Rule Set
• Capture Rules
• Propagation Rules
• Apply Rules
• Contexts
• Transformations

Instantiation

• Capture process for Instantiation
• Oracle Data Pump for Instantiation
• Export and Import for Instantiation

The Role of Streams Tags

• How to create
• Utility of Tags
• Tags for Apply Process

 
 

This is a BC Oracle training course (c) 2007-2016

 

   

Burleson is the American Team

Note: This Oracle documentation was created as a support and Oracle training reference for use by our DBA performance tuning consulting professionals.  Feel free to ask questions on our Oracle forum.

Verify experience! Anyone considering using the services of an Oracle support expert should independently investigate their credentials and experience, and not rely on advertisements and self-proclaimed expertise. All legitimate Oracle experts publish their Oracle qualifications.

Errata?  Oracle technology is changing and we strive to update our BC Oracle support information.  If you find an error or have a suggestion for improving our content, we would appreciate your feedback.  Just  e-mail:  

and include the URL for the page.


                    









Burleson Consulting

The Oracle of Database Support

Oracle Performance Tuning

Remote DBA Services


 

Copyright © 1996 -  2017

All rights reserved by Burleson

Oracle ® is the registered trademark of Oracle Corporation.

Remote Emergency Support provided by Conversational